HS2 Delta Junction | Specialist Labour and Civils Support | Rorcon

Rorcon supported Balfour Beatty VINCI on one of the most complex sections of the HS2 route, supplying specialist formwork carpenters, scaffolders, chargehands and lifting supervisors to deliver key elements of the Delta Junction structures. The works demanded a disciplined approach to safety, coordination and technical execution, given the scale of the asset and the number of interfaces involved.

Our team integrated directly with BBV’s delivery operation and maintained consistent manpower levels throughout the programme. The focus was on providing reliable, high-calibre tradespeople who could work within a major-project environment and meet the quality and efficiency standards required on HS2. Each phase relied on tight sequencing, controlled lifting operations and close communication with BBV’s supervision teams, which meant our workforce had to perform at a consistently high level without disrupting the wider delivery plan.

Rorcon’s involvement contributed to maintaining progress across several critical structures and supported the project’s wider objectives for safety, productivity and programme certainty. The steady and dependable labour supply reduced resourcing risk for BBV and helped ensure that key activities were executed on time and to the standard expected on a nationally significant infrastructure scheme.
